#ab704b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ab704b is composed of 67.1% red, 43.9%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.5% magenta, 56.1%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 23.1 degrees, a saturation of 39% and a lightness of 48.2%. #ab704b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e096 with #570000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#ab704b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070503 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ab704b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7b7a is the less saturated color, while #ed6109 is the most saturated one.
